Faith & Science Conference Brings Educators, Scientists Together to "Affirm Creation"

August 2, 2017 By admin

**To share this story: By Kimberly Luste Maran   Raul Esperante, senior researcher at the Geoscience Research Institute, gives a presentation on the fossil record at the Faith & Science Conference on July 6, 2017. Photo by Pieter Damsteegt     More than 330 educators, scientists, and theologians gathered July 6 through 14 for eight full days of lectures, field trips, networking, and inspiration in St. George, Utah, at the 2017 Faith and Science Conference. The conference, themed “Affirming Creation,” was coordinated by the North American Division Office of Education and the Geoscience Research Institute, and hosted by the Faith & Science Council of the General Conference.

Loma Linda University Expands Nuclear Medicine Program to Bachelor’s Degree

August 2, 2017 By admin

**To share this story: Redesigned from certificate program, four-year degree meets industry’s demand; little-known profession has great opportunities for employment, salary, and service, program director says.   Photo provided by Loma Linda University Health   Loma Linda University’s  School of Allied Health Professions  has introduced a bachelor’s degree in nuclear medicine, expanding the program from a certificate in an effort to meet the needs of the industry that is increasingly seeking graduates of a four-year program.   Nuclear medicine is a specialty that uses nuclear properties of radioactive and stable nuclides to make diagnostic evaluations of a body’s physiological conditions on a cellular level. Unlike an X-ray, which uses radiation to scan a body, nuclear medicine uses radiation from a person’s body to detect things on a microscopic level, such as tumors or abnormal vascular or cardiac function.   The nuclear medicine program at the School of Allied Health Professions includes computed tomography (CT), which means graduates can also sit for the CT boards.

In Kansas City Area, "Hear Their Voices" Event Aims to Help End Human Sex Trafficking

August 2, 2017 By admin

**To share this story:  By Brenda Dickerson   Photo by iStock   Hear Their Voices, a partnership between the Seventh-day Adventist Church and Veronica’s Voice, is hosting a community event Sept. 9-10 in Kansas City to offer educational resources for prevention of human sex trafficking and bring healing and support to existing survivors.   The Kansas City metropolitan area has the second highest incidences of domestic minor sex trafficking in the United States. iBelieve Bible Witnesses to Young People Where They Are

August 2, 2017 By admin

**To share this story:  By Adam Fenner   Photo by Dan Weber     The foundational impetus behind the North American Division’s iBelieve Bible Study is to witness to young people where they are, which is in the digital realm. The iBelieve Bible Study is a free online curriculum designed to strengthen the faith of youth and young adults in and outside the Seventh-day Adventist Church. iBelieve Bible is made up of four main components that are released incrementally throughout the week. This includes short blog posts, short videos, social media interaction, and online Bible studies. Only partially an event and community occasion like traditional Sabbath school and Bible studies, iBelieve Bible is a regular interjection of biblical themes and topics into the daily lives of people that culminates on Friday afternoons, leading up to and in preparation for the Sabbath.
